matrix 環境|LaTeX
matrix 環境は行列を表示するための環境です。括弧の種類によって複数のバリエーションがあります。
matrix(括弧なし)
括弧のない行列を作成します。
\[
\begin{matrix}
a & b \\
c & d
\end{matrix}
\]
& で列を区切り、\\ で行を区切ります。
pmatrix(丸括弧)
丸括弧で囲まれた行列です。ベクトルや座標の表記によく使います。
\[
\begin{pmatrix}
a & b \\
c & d
\end{pmatrix}
\]
bmatrix(角括弧)
角括弧で囲まれた行列です。
\[
\begin{bmatrix}
1 & 2 & 3 \\
4 & 5 & 6 \\
7 & 8 & 9
\end{bmatrix}
\]
vmatrix(縦線・行列式)
縦線で囲まれた形式で、行列式を表すときに使います。
\[
\begin{vmatrix}
a & b \\
c & d
\end{vmatrix}
= ad - bc
\]
Vmatrix(二重縦線)
二重縦線で囲まれた行列です。ノルムを表すときなどに使います。
\[
\begin{Vmatrix}
a & b \\
c & d
\end{Vmatrix}
\]
Bmatrix(波括弧)
波括弧で囲まれた行列です。
\[
\begin{Bmatrix}
a & b \\
c & d
\end{Bmatrix}
\]
列ベクトル
列ベクトルは 1 列の行列として書きます。
\[
\mathbf{v} = \begin{pmatrix}
x \\
y \\
z
\end{pmatrix}
\]
行ベクトル
行ベクトルは 1 行の行列として書きます。
\[
\mathbf{v}^T = \begin{pmatrix}
x & y & z
\end{pmatrix}
\]
省略記号を含む行列
大きな行列では省略記号を使います。
\[
A = \begin{pmatrix}
a_{11} & a_{12} & \cdots & a_{1n} \\
a_{21} & a_{22} & \cdots & a_{2n} \\
\vdots & \vdots & \ddots & \vdots \\
a_{m1} & a_{m2} & \cdots & a_{mn}
\end{pmatrix}
\]
\cdots は横方向、\vdots は縦方向、\ddots は対角方向の省略記号です。
単位行列
単位行列の例です。
\[
I_3 = \begin{pmatrix}
1 & 0 & 0 \\
0 & 1 & 0 \\
0 & 0 & 1
\end{pmatrix}
\]
拡大係数行列
連立方程式の拡大係数行列は array 環境を使うとより見やすくなりますが、matrix でも書けます。
\[
\left(\begin{matrix}
1 & 2 & 3 \\
4 & 5 & 6
\end{matrix}\middle|\begin{matrix}
7 \\
8
\end{matrix}\right)
\]